
MINSK, 13 August (BelTA) – Chairman of the Central Election Commission (CEC) of Belarus Igor Karpenko and First Deputy Secretary General of the Commonwealth of Independent States (CIS) Igor Petrishenko discussed preparations for the 2nd International Electoral Forum on 13 August, the CEC press service told BelTA.
The forum will become a venue where professionals and everyone else taking an interest in the electoral law and electoral technologies will be able to have an open discussion. The central event of the forum will be an international science to practice conference on forming the legal culture of the population as a factor of harmonization and stability of the election process.
The forum will also include a roundtable session on challenges and opportunities of the electoral culture in the youth environment, a panel discussion on problems and solutions concerning the spiritual and moral foundations of forming the legal awareness and the legal culture of young people.
